Transaction 19d3d6d3cb90fef5af006fc4e1b5094c5d3f15415f187a8d588482527c2b01c8
1 Input
1 Outputs
- 19d3d6d3cb90fef5af006fc4e1b5094c5d3f15415f187a8d588482527c2b01c8:0
value 58318307
address 16Yx3dLKPvsWH2m3cMNpqGSHqiL6wcCgqT